The most popular turboprop ever created, Beechcraft's King Airs are best known for the generous size of their cabins (bigger than many jets), their operating efficiency and their incredible reliability. Produced continuously since 1964, King Airs have earned a fierce loyalty among both passengers and pilots.
WebBeechcraft King Air 350 Turboprops for Sale The Beechcraft King Air 350 is the largest turboprop in the Beechcraft family, being based on the King Air 300 but with a 34-inch longer fuselage, two extra windows and longer wings with winglets. The extra length allows for eight seats in double club layout and there is a ninth seat in the a restroom.
